Not sure how you would get a closed loop when using the inverter in the tow vehicle.
You are not using the trailer battery, you are using the tow vehicle battery.
If you are hooked up to the 7-way plug, the converter will attempt to charge both the trailer and Tow Vehicle. I'm not aware of any OEM that include a diode to the trailer charge circuit. If you're disconnected from the 7-way, it's not an issue.
Would not hurt a thing.
Chances are the vehicles charging circuit would be above the voltage of the converter. Thus. the converter will not be putting out much. If the vehicles voltage level is below the converters then the conv will charge everything - again, no issue.
It's also no different than plugging in the RV while the vehicle is connected and running.
Either way, it isn't a short and wont hurt anything at all.
Years ago I did exactly as the OP describes to power my 2 way fridge and had no problems.
